In order to increase your license limits, please contact Impero or contact your account manager. If the number of active Console/Workstation sessions reaches the limits displayed in this window, any new Console/Workstation connection will fail until a currently active session ends, or your number of licenses is increased. Workstation Limit This is the number of remote workstations that you are currently licenced to concurrently manage with the Impero client. Console Limit This is the number of Impero Consoles that you are currently licenced to run at any one time. Establishment Name The name of your company.
